Hello I have pakistani passport .
I recently applied for student visa to study in Italy which has been rejected can any one  please guide me on how to make an appeal,

There are three reason stated there.

1) The documentation submitted in support of visa is unreliable.
2)your intention to leave the member state before the expiry of visa cannot be assured.
3)you did not prove the means of subsistence under interior ministry directive  of 2000.

Wow, quite many reasons for rejecting the application. You submit the appeal to the embassy where you applied for the visa. You have 15 or 30 days to file the appeal (it should say in the letter), the sooner you file the appeal, the better. Here is a link to a sample visa appeal (sample visa appeal). This is only a sample, edit and customize the text to suit your situation.

When you file the visa appeal, you need to prove that you are right about all the denial statements.

1) courses registration, supporting letter from the school, information about the study programme, boarding agreement, fee receipt, etc.
2) information about your family, residence, etc. which suggests that you have a place to return after your study is completed
3) bank account statement, credit card statement showing credit limit, etc.
